
GREEN BAY (WKOW) -- The Green Bay Packers are set to release a report on Tuesday showing how they did financially last season as defending Super Bowl champs.
The Packers release an annual report every year.
In the 2010-2011 season, the Packers had $12 million in profits from operations.
The team finished last season with a 15-1 record. That paid off when the team held its fifth stock sale in team history. The Packers sold more than 268,000 shares, bringing in $67 million in six weeks.
Green Bay opens its season at home September 9 against San Francisco.
